Call Of The Wild
See the way the sunlight splashes across my face
Serenaded by swaying leaves in a beautiful place
I yearn for the mornings when dew makes leaves glisten
And as nature sings and dances I simply listen
A lush forest forms a canopy overhead
Where birds perch and make their bed
In roaring rivers fish make their home
Twisting and twining to the heart of the biome
Here I forget the city's hustle
As I watch forest squirrels bustle
Deep within the forest comes the call of the wild
Filling me with gleeful joy like that of a child
...From my gilded concrete cage
It seems so real it fills me with rage
Knowing that what I yearn for is surreal
Because it was truly never real
This sprawling urban jungle is not where I should be
So cramped and crowded it's impossible to be free
Perhaps that's why my heart is sick and I lost all hope
Chasing booze and bottles just to cope
When I close my eyes I can still see that pretty lie
But as soon as I open them I have to ask why
My soul yearns for a life that was never mine
I begin to wonder if I just want to whine
But tonight when I close my eyes
Whether ugly truths or pretty lies
Whether it's right or wrong
My heart knows where I belong
And again the sunlight splashes across my face
Serenaded by swaying leaves in a beautiful place
As tears begin to fall I cry like a child
Just wanting it to be true that call of the wild
